Description

Racking in and out on the Swiss Line rack

The Swiss Line J-Hooks are the barbell rest for your Swiss Line rack. You slot them into the row of holes, the pin at the top secures them, and from there your bar sits at whatever height the next lift needs. Back squat low, bench in between, rack pull up high – moving them in the 5 cm pattern takes a few seconds, with no tools at all.

The real difference sits in the second plastic rest. One lies in the cradle and takes the barbell. The second sits in the mount against the upright. Meaning: no metal on metal – neither on your bar nor on your rack's coating. Exactly where you reposition most often.

Fits the Swiss Line – and nowhere else

These hooks belong to the Swiss Line: 80 x 80 mm profile, 17 mm holes, 5 cm spacing. Within the series they fit everywhere – racks, rigs, squat stands. The Swiss Line is made in Switzerland, from the engineering through to production.

Not compatible is the A-Line with its 75 x 75 mm profile. Five millimetres of difference, and the hook no longer sits snug on the upright – for that we have the J-Hooks. So what counts for you is one single measurement: the width of your upright.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will the Swiss Line J-Hooks fit my rack?
Every rack, rig and squat stand from the Swiss Line. The profile there measures 80 x 80 mm in 4 mm steel, the holes are 17 mm, spaced 5 cm apart. They do not go on an A-Line upright with 75 x 75 mm.
How do I tell which series I have?
Lay a tape measure across the upright. 80 mm means Swiss Line, 75 mm means A-Line. If your rack comes from another series: send us the profile width and hole diameter and we will check the figures.
Are the Swiss Line J-Hooks the better version?
No, they are the other one. Swiss Line and A-Line are two systems with different profiles, not quality grades. What you need depends purely on the rack standing in your gym.
What does the second plastic rest do for me?
It sits between hook and upright. That stops steel rubbing on steel, so your rack's coating stays intact in the spots where you reposition most often. The rest in the cradle does the same for the barbell.
